If your TV powers on but the colors look like a "negative" or are highly distorted, your LVDS settings in the service menu or firmware map are incorrect.

Some hardware variants of the T.VST59.031 board use modified bootloaders that reject standard file names. If the board boots up normally and ignores the update, try appending an "R" to the binary file name (e.g., rename it to LAMV59R.bin ) to force the initial flash cycle.

The ITV.V59.031 is a highly versatile universal LCD/LED TV controller board powered by the (or similar) microcontroller. It is widely used by technicians and hobbyists because it supports a massive variety of TFT LCD panels, ranging from resolutions of 1366 × 768 up to 1920 × 1200.
